    I have limited knowledge on thyroid issues - what I do know is that TPO antibodies and hashimotos go hand in hand. Thyroiditis is a broad term that seems to include many forms of thyroid conditions due to auto immune issues. You might ask your doctor about LDN (low dose naltrexone.) Some have had good success lowering their TPO's with it. Regardless,the information on it shows it to be very cancer fighting and can generate a higher sense of wellbeing.

    Hashimotos accounts for a large percentage of thyroid issues. It seems to be quite common. Usually TPO's are tested along with TSH, and the free T3's and 4's. I'm surprised your Doc did not rule out Hashi's from the get go. Armour is still a suitable medicine to use for this condition.
